Management Of Stroke

What’s new?

  • The risk of recurrent stroke after TIA or minor stroke is higher than previously thought

  • The early risk of recurrent stroke can be calculated using a simple clinical score, the ‘ABCD’ score

  • The MATCH trial has shown no additional benefit with clopidogrel and aspirin over clopidogrel alone in prevention of recurrent stroke or vascular events

  • The ESPRIT trial has shown benefit of aspirin and dipyridamole over aspirin alone in the secondary prevention of stroke

  • The efficacy of carotid surgery for secondary prevention of stroke in patients with symptomatic carotid stenosis is highly dependent on the timing of surgery

There are various clinical and pathological subtypes of stroke, and identification of the subtype is necessary for correct management.
